VB6.0算术运算符

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

算术运算符的使用:

运算符说明优先级

^ 乘方 1

- 取负数 2

* 乘 3

/ 除 4

\ 整除 5

Mod 取余 6

+ 加7

- 减8

字符运算符用来连接两个字符串的符号,Visual Basic中有两个字符串运算符,分别是“+”和“&”,使用时应注意以下特点:

“+”连接字符串时,如果一边操作数为数值型,另一边的操作数为非数值型,系统会出错。

“+”连接字符串时,如果一边操作数为数值型,另一边的操作数为非数值型,系统会自动将数值字符型转换为数值型,然后执行相加。

“&”连接字符时,系统会自动将连接的操作数转换成字符型,然后相连。

“&”连接字符时,需要在“&”两边左右各加一个空格符,否则会出错。

运算符说明

= 等于

<> 不等于

>= 大于或者等于

<= 小于或者等于

> 大于

< 小于

like 字符串匹配

is 对像引用比较

关系运算符用于返回True或False

运算符说明优先级

1 Not 非,当操作数为真时,结果为

假,反之结果为真。

2 And 与,当两个操作数为真时,结

果为真。

3 Or 或,当两个操作数中一个为真

时,结果为真。

4 Xor 异或,当两操作数一真一假

时,结果为真。

Eqv 相等,当两个操作数逻辑值相

5

等时,结果为真。

Imp 蕴含,第一个操作数逻辑值为

6

真,第二个操作数逻辑值为

假,结果为假,其余情况均为

真。

逻辑运算符用于逻辑型数据类型的运算,结果为True或False.当操作数为数值型数据时,系统将数值型数据转换成16位整型或32位长整型的二进制数据,然后再进行运算.如果是浮点型数据,则系统进行四舍五入为整数后转换为二进制数再进行位运算.Visual Basic6.0中提供了6种逻辑运算符.

相关文档
最新文档